**Responsibilities**:

- Provide HR generalist and advisory services to the Business Unit and ensure a consistent and integrated approach to HR activities and solutions in PG
- Provide a full spectrum of HR services including performance management, compensation and benefits, and employee engagement
- Handle all aspects of personnel administration, payroll and benefits process
- Maintain accurate HR data through HRIS
- Manage the onboarding and offboarding process
- Ensure compliance to regional or local policies, legal or any statutory requirements under employment legislation
- Lead and facilitate PG culture engagement activities such as corporate social responsibility event, team bonding & learning / development events
- Ensure timely communication of changes in policies, programs and procedures
- Assist in implementing compensation and benefits procedures
- Liaise with Regional HR to resolve any local HR Operations concerns
- Work with payroll vendor on the delivery of our payroll function ensuring that each pay run is accurate, timely and compliant.
- To ensure that all transaction support processes are systemized and streamlined for the best user experience.
- Working with our outsourced partners to ensuring all employees have a legal right to work in all of our markets across Asia
- Oversee case management of all visa queries, ensuring that appropriate working visas are obtained and retained for all employees
- Oversee all mobility cases to ensure that risks and requirements associated with working rights and tax are understood and managed effectively
- To be on top of all the changes from the authorities in regard to the latest guidelines and policies with foreign hiring.
- People Services support and compliance
- Oversee the provision of people support services, ensuring that the team prioritize caseloads and queries within agreed timeframes
- Collaborate with key stakeholders to develop and implement regional HR policies and procedures.
- Oversee coordination of recognition program.
